Leidos is seeking a Cyber Security Engineer with an extensive background as an infrastructure engineer, coupled with proven coding skills. This role is designed for an individual who is keen on leveraging their technical expertise to fortify the security framework within a dynamic environment. The role will lead initiatives to integrate security at every phase of the development lifecycle, ensuring the robustness and compliance of our applications and infrastructure. In this role, you will be working across both infrastructure and security space reporting into the System Technical Lead and the Cyber Security Engineering Lead.
Key Responsibilities
Support the update process for Commercial Off-The-Shelf (COTS) applications, ensuring compatibility and security.
Conduct regular vulnerability scanning of environments to identify vulnerabilities.
Manage and update security definitions across platforms to protect against emerging threats.
Analyse vulnerability assessment reports and implement necessary changes.
Perform thorough daily checks of security components to ensure operational integrity.
Conduct daily system health checks to ensure servers are functioning optimally.
Monitor and report on local system capacity, suggesting improvements where necessary.
Support application patching to resolve security issues and enhance system performance.
Oversee log archiving and deletion processes to maintain a streamlined log management system.
Update local admin account passwords and manage account policies to maintain security.
Implement and manage resource and system monitoring tools and practices.
Ensure local server backups are conducted regularly and effectively.
Review and update engineering and design documents and standard operating procedures periodically.
Schedule and execute server and application reboots as part of preventive maintenance.
Perform full audits of all technologies for interoperability and patch compliance.
Oversee daily checks of Public Key Infrastructure and manage the lifecycle of secrets securely.
Execute comprehensive vulnerability scanning on all applications and lead the analysis and triage of findings.
Review code for potential security issues prior to production releases.
